Output cadb656bfde84caaeb92c606a6c52d4df4a58aa5bce9a0fcbcd0b08318640b53:9

value
11793511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64da220dfd441b748c8ca6294f4f22a4e57bbac9 OP_EQUAL
address
MH6R7m8CpgNLBhig2bsKGuakYts6Q81WYS
transaction
cadb656bfde84caaeb92c606a6c52d4df4a58aa5bce9a0fcbcd0b08318640b53
spent
true